Facilities Ticket — Cleaning Crew Access, Brindle Annex

For new starters handling evening lock-up: the Sorano Cleaning crew arrives nightly at 21:30 via the annex side door. Check their rota sheet, note arrival in the log, and ensure the storeroom is relocked afterward. To let them through the side door, enter the access code below.

badge for yaweg-hafog: bdg-GX-6

Runbook: Shelfwright catalogue import. Plugin authors: imports run nightly against the Marrowfield staging catalogue. Your ingest plugin must emit records in CDF-3; anything else is quarantined. Retry failed batches with `shelfctl import --resume`. The importer authenticates to the catalogue gateway via an env-supplied credential; without it all batches quarantine silently. Before running locally, open your plugin env file and add the gateway secret on the line that follows.

sealed setting: ARCHIVE_KEY3=8d0

Step 3: After the incremental rebuild finishes on Fernhollow, diff the changed-pages manifest against the trigger list; mismatches mean a stale cache layer, so purge and rerun. Never force a full rebuild during business hours without lead approval. Publishing requires the signed manifest, which uses the deploy key below.

rollout seal: bky4_DFM9

Quick update for the sync: we're finally sunsetting Queuebert, our homegrown job queue, in favor of the managed Taskforge service from Ortlan Systems. The pilot team moved their billing jobs over last sprint and throughput roughly doubled, with far fewer stuck-job pages. Contract terms look reasonable; procurement has the redlines. Remaining risk is the priority-lane feature, which Ortlan says ships next quarter. If your team has workloads that depend on strict ordering, flag it early with the migration leads.

escalation mailbox, bafog-fafog: ulador@paliqlabs.internal